2014-11-14 156 views
0

我會開始說我從來沒有創建一個需要安裝的應用程序,我不知道它是如何工作的。但現在我必須,而且我想知道如何繼續,使用某種安裝工具(installshield,wix)或創建一個python腳本並轉換成一個.exe文件。創建安裝文件

什麼我的安裝需要做的是:

  • 創建一個文件夾,並通過HTTP添加到系統路徑
  • 檢查回購的文件的最新版本,並將其下載到該文件夾​​

我該如何解決這個問題? 另外,如果我使用任何安裝工具,是否可以使用該安裝文件進行更新?

回答

1

通常的方式分發和安裝Python包的描述如下:

https://hynek.me/articles/sharing-your-labor-of-love-pypi-quick-and-dirty/

但我不能肯定這是你在找什麼。 如果我把字面上你的問題:

  • 創建一個文件夾,並通過HTTP添加到系統路徑
  • 檢查回購的文件的最新版本,並將其下載到該文件夾​​

我會去找一個Python腳本,因爲它不是太複雜,然後你完全控制。

1

構建Windows安裝程序的推薦方法是使用Windows Installer技術。您可以嘗試使用付費安裝程序工具(如InstallShield,高級安裝程序或任何基於Windows Installer的工具)或使用免費WiX來創建您的設置。

關於第二個問題,我不知道WiX是否提供了任何內置更新工具,但大多數付費安裝程序工具都有用於處理和部署安裝更新的內置工具。